The University of California Regents' Committee to Advise the President on the Selection of a Chancellor of the Riverside Campus and the Committee on Educational Policy will meet jointly in closed session to discuss matters related to the appointment and employment of a new chancellor for UC Riverside on Monday, Dec. 10, at 1111 Franklin St., in Oakland. The meeting will begin at 10 a.m. and adjourn at approximately 3 p.m.
The advisory committee includes five regents who also serve on the regents' Committee on Educational Policy, which would constitute a quorum of the latter group.
No educational policy committee business will be considered at the meeting.
